Tema 8_сiтьовое_план.ppt
- Количество слайдов: 32
Тема: Методи планування проекту 1. Розвиток методів планування 2. Сітьові моделі
1. Розвиток методів планування
Спочатку використовувалися досить прості засоби і методи: лінійні діаграми; таблиці трудових витрат, таблиці витрат ресурсів, у яких зазначені терміни підготовки робочої документації, початок експлуатації, терміни по інших етапах і ресурси, необхідні для їх здійснення; таблиці обладнання, що містять дані про типи обладнання, терміни постачання; фінансові таблиці, що відображають витрати і прибутки. Потім почали використовувати методи дослідження операцій, сітьові методи, наприклад метод критичного шляху.
Методи сітьового планування Основна мета - скорочення до мінімуму тривалості проекту. Базуються на методах, розроблених практично одночасно й незалежно: метод критичного шляху (МКШ) (англ. – Critical Path Method - CPM) і метод оцінки та перегляду планів (ПЕРТ) (англ. – Program Evaluation and Review Technique - PERT).
Метод критичного шляху (МКШ) краще використовувати тоді, коли операції проекту мають визначену тривалість, Метод ПЕРТ більш ефективний якщо оцінки тривалості мають ймовірнісний характер. Загальна умова - для реалізації події повинні бути завершені усі попередні операції.
Сітьова діаграма (сіть, граф сіті, PERT-діаграма) – графічне відображення робіт проекту і залежностей між ними.
2. Сітьові моделі
Сітьове планування - це побудова сітьового графіка та обчислення його параметрів Для побудови сітьового графіка потрібно мати: • список робіт • логічні зв'язки між роботами
Робота (операція) - дія, необхідна для реалізації проекту Роботи в сітьових графіках мають свій номер або код, який присвоюється їм при побудові WBS - структури
Логічні зв'язки Послідовні, коли одна робота виконується після другої; Паралельні, коли кілька робіт можуть виконуватися одночасно
Сітьові моделі доцільно використовувати тільки для складних проектів. Існує три типи сіток: • сіті "вершини-події"; • сіті типу "вершини-роботи“ (сіті передування); • змішані сіті.
Сіті типу "вершини-події" (стрілчасті) Сіті такого виду часто називаються IJ сітями, оскільки кожна робота визначається номером IJ (початок/кінець). У сітях цього типу робота зображується стрілкою між двома вузлами і визначається номерами вузлів, які вона зв'язує.
Стрілчастий графік Роботи А і В паралельні А 2 С 4 1 В 3 D Е 5
Зображення роботи в сіті IJ
Хоча стрілчасті сіті менш популярні, ніж сіті передування, їх все ще застосовують у деяких прикладних сферах. В IJ-сітях використовують тільки залежності «фініш-старт» , тому є необхідність використання фіктивних робіт для правильного визначення всіх логічних зв'язків. Креслять діаграми IJ вручну або з допомогою комп'ютера.
Сіті типу "вершини-роботи" або сіті передування А С Е В D
Зображення роботи в сіті передування
Типи логічних залежностей між роботами закінчення-початок: робота В не може початися, поки не закінчиться робота А. Це стандартна ситуація, коли наступна робота не може розпочатись, поки не закінчиться попередня; закінчення-закінчення: робота D не може закінчитися, поки не закінчиться робота С. Використовується для моделювання паралельних робіт;
Типи логічних залежностей між роботами (закінчення) початок-початок: робота D не може початися поки не почнеться С. Використовується для моделювання робіт, які виконуються одночасно; початок-закінчення: робота F не може закінчитися поки не почнеться Е. Використовується для робіт, виконуваних вахтовим методом.
Затримка/випередження наступна робота не може розпочатись раніше, ніж через два дні після завершення попередньої роботи наступна робота розпочинається на три дні раніше, ніж завершиться попередня робота
Розрахунок сітьової моделі 1. Визначення переліку й послідовності виконання робіт. Графічна побудова сітьового графіка. 2. Означення тривалості роботи. 3. Визначення термінів початку і завершення робіт шляхом “прямого проходження” по сіті. 4. Визначення пізніх термінів початку і завершення робіт шляхом “ зворотного проходження” по сіті. 5. Визначення критичного шляху і запасу часу по роботах
Послідовність побудови графіка 1. Визначити перелік і послідовність виконання робіт на основі WBSструктури (визначається менеджером проекту) 2. Накреслити сітьовий графік із зображенням робіт і логічних зв'язків між ними 3. Позначити на графіку тривалість кожної роботи
Прядок побудови графіка (продовження) 4. Визначити ранні терміни початку і закінчення робіт (пряме проходження по сіті) Ранні дати початку (ES – Early Start) і закінчення (EF - Early Finish) робіт ESi+1 = EFi + 1; EFi = ESi + ti -1. EFi - ранній термін завершення і-ї роботи; ESi - ранній термін початку і-ї роботи; ti – тривалість і-ї роботи; ESi+1 - ранній початок роботи і+1.
Прядок побудови графіка (продовження) Якщо певна робота виконується після кількох попередніх ранній термін початку цієї роботи визначається з огляду на найпізніший з ранніх термінів закінчення попередніх робіт. Раннє закінчення перетворюється у наступній роботі у ранній початок відніманням випередження або додаванням запізнення, які передбачають залежність закінченняпочаток
Прядок побудови графіка (продовження) Цей крок дає можливість визначити тривалість усього проекту.
Прядок побудови графіка (продовження) 5. Визначити пізні терміни початку і завершення робіт шляхом “зворотнього проходження” по сіті Пізні дати пізнього початку (LS – Late Start) і закінчення (LF - Late Finish) робіт LSi = LFi -ti +1; LFi+1 = LSi -1. LSi - пізній термін початку і-ї роботи; LFi - пізній термін завершення і-ї роботи; ti – тривалість і-ї роботи; LSi+1 - пізній термін початку роботи і+1.
Прядок побудови графіка (продовження) Якщо після певної роботи йдуть дві паралельні, то пізнє завершення цієї роботи визначається з огляду на найбільш ранній з пізніх початків наступних робіт
Прядок побудови графіка (продовження) 6. Визначити критичний шлях і резерв часу по роботах Роботи, у яких ранні й пізні терміни початку й закінчення збігаються, називаються критичними. Критичний шлях утворюється послідовністю критичних робіт. Це найдовший з усіх існуючих у проекті шляхів, який показує найменший час, який потрібно, для виконання усіх робіт за проектом.
Прядок побудови графіка (продовження) Резерв часу (F - Float) – це той максимальний час, на який можна відкласти початок некритичної роботи, без зміни тривалості усього проекту. Fi = LSi - ESi; Fi = LFi - EFi;
Задача: Розробка ТЗ на створення інформаційної служби Код Назва роботи А Розробка основних положень Б В Г Виявлення основних задач Визначення оргструктури ІС Розробка вимог до технологічного процесу обробки інформації Розробка вимог до програмнотехнічної бази та попереднє її визначення Розробка вимог до приміщення ІС Д Є Ж Визначення переліку витрат на створення ІС Попередня робота Затримка або випередження Трудомісткість (ч. /дн) Кількість виконавців Тривалість - - 22 4 8 40 14 18 2 3 2 28 7 13 16 2 12 18 14 2 2 13 10 А Б А В, Г А, Д Є Випередження 5 дн. Випередження 4 дн. Затримка 2 дн.
Задача: Розробка ТЗ на створення інформаційної служби (закінчення) Втрати робочого часу з різних причин (хвороби, навчання, свята тощо) - 30%. Визначити: • коефіцієнт втрат робочого часу, • тривалість кожної роботи. • скласти сітьовий графік методом критичного шляху, використовуючи сітки типу “вершини - роботи”.